Context Readings
Israel's Stability
3 For the rod of the wicked shall not rest on the lot of the righteous; lest the righteous put forth their hands to iniquity. 4 Do good, O Jehovah, to the good, and to the upright in their hearts. 5 And those who turn aside to their crooked ways, Jehovah shall lead them forth with the workers of iniquity; peace shall be on Israel.
